I am a library media specialist at a school district in southeast Michigan where I must split my time between the high school (3 days/week) and the middle school (2 days/week). After teaching high school English in western Michigan in the 1970s I left teaching for the world of marketing and public relations for 20 years. Eleven years ago I regained my sanity and came back to teaching. In 2004 I took over a middle school/elementary library position while completing my masters in library and information science. You could say I'm a late bloomer since it took me nearly 40 years to finally find my true niche in life.
